Fri Nov 01 15:42:17 UTC 2024: ## Rohit Shetty’s “Singham Again” Reimagines Ramayana with Cop Universe Twist

Rohit Shetty’s latest action-comedy, “Singham Again,” takes the classic tale of Ramayana and reimagines it with his signature brand of cop universe action, humor, and drama. Ajay Devgn leads the charge as Bajirao Singham, channeling the spirit of Ram, while Arjun Kapoor plays Zubair aka Danger Lanka, a villain seeking revenge for his family, echoing the role of Ravana.

The film boasts a star-studded cast, with Ranveer Singh as Simmba, representing Hanuman, Akshay Kumar as Sooryavanshi, stepping into the role of Garuda, and Tiger Shroff as Satya, a nod to Laxman. Deepika Padukone joins the franchise as Shakti Shetty, a powerful character inspired by Sugreev.

While the story follows the familiar path of Ramayana, Shetty brings a contemporary twist, blending mythology with a modern setting. The film is peppered with meta jokes, witty references to other films, and clever dialogues that add to the entertainment value.

“Singham Again” excels in its action sequences, with car chases, explosions, and breathtaking stunts. The film also boasts strong performances from the entire cast, with Devgn leading the way as the righteous Singham, Kapoor as the menacing villain, and Singh providing comic relief.

Despite its strengths, the film has its shortcomings. The VFX in Akshay Kumar’s sequences falter, and the absence of a musical score is a missed opportunity. The film also falls prey to jingoism with its use of popular dialogues and nationalist sentiments.

However, Shetty delivers enough wow moments to make “Singham Again” an engaging watch. The post-credit scene featuring Salman Khan as Chulbul Pandey, announcing “Mission Chulbul Singham,” is sure to pique audience curiosity and leave them wanting more.
